Google has recently announced a significant update to its search engine, allowing users to search for symbols such as punctuation marks and other characters directly. This enhancement is part of the company's ongoing efforts to improve the user experience and make searching more intuitive and efficient.
The new feature enables users to find specific symbols without having to navigate through menus or guess their codes. For example, a user searching for a trademark symbol can simply type "TM" into the search bar, and Google will display results that include the symbol.
This update is particularly beneficial for content creators, designers, and anyone who needs to find or insert specific symbols into their work. It also helps in finding information related to special characters, such as those used in foreign languages or mathematical equations.
To use the symbol search feature, simply start your search query with the symbol you're looking for. Google will automatically recognize the request and provide relevant results.
